खोज…


टिप्पणियों

विभिन्न प्रकार के सिरी अनुरोध

  • सवारी बुकिंग (उदाहरण के लिए MyApp के माध्यम से न्यूयॉर्क के लिए एक सवारी प्राप्त करें)

  • मैसेजिंग (जैसे MyApp का उपयोग करके जॉन को एक पाठ भेजें)

  • फोटो खोज (जैसे MyApp में पिछली गर्मियों में ली गई समुद्र तट की तस्वीरें देखें)

  • भुगतान (जैसे MyApp का उपयोग करके रात के खाने के लिए जॉन को $ 20 भेजें)

  • वीओआईपी कॉलिंग (उदाहरण के लिए माय माइक पर कॉल करें)

  • वर्कआउट (उदाहरण के लिए MyApp से अपने दैनिक रन वर्कआउट शुरू करें)

  • जलवायु और रेडियो (विशेष रूप से कारप्ले के लिए डिज़ाइन किया गया, उदाहरण के लिए हीटर को 72 डिग्री पर सेट करें)

ऐप में सिरी एक्सटेंशन जोड़ना

अपने ऐप में सिरी क्षमताओं को एकीकृत करने के लिए, आपको एक एक्सटेंशन जोड़ना चाहिए जैसा कि आप iOS 10 विजेट (पुराने आज का दृश्य एक्सटेंशन) या कस्टम कीबोर्ड बनाते समय करते हैं।

क्षमता जोड़ना

1- प्रोजेक्ट सेटिंग्स में, अपने iOS ऐप लक्ष्य का चयन करें और क्षमताओं टैब पर जाएं

2- सिरी क्षमता को सक्षम करें

एक्सटेंशन जोड़ना

1- फाइल पर जाएं -> नया -> लक्ष्य ...

2- बाएं फलक से iOS -> एप्लिकेशन एक्सटेंशन का चयन करें

3- राइट से इंटेंस एक्सटेंशन को डबल-क्लिक करें

Apple के अनुसार:

Intents Extension टेम्पलेट एक Intents एक्सटेंशन बनाता है जो आपके ऐप को सिरी और मैप्स जैसी सिस्टम सेवाओं द्वारा जारी किए गए इंटेंट्स को संभालने की अनुमति देता है।

यहाँ छवि विवरण दर्ज करें

4- एक नाम चुनें, और "यूआई एक्सटेंशन शामिल करें" जांचना सुनिश्चित करें

यहाँ छवि विवरण दर्ज करें

इस चरण को करने से, दो नए लक्ष्य (इंटेंट एक्सटेंशन और UI एक्सटेंशन) बनाए जाते हैं, और डिफ़ॉल्ट रूप से उनमें वर्कआउट इंटेंट कोड होता है। विभिन्न प्रकार के सिरी अनुरोधों के लिए, रिमार्क्स देखें।

ध्यान दें

कभी भी आप अपने एक्सटेंशन को डिबग करना चाहते हैं, बस उपलब्ध योजनाओं से आशय योजना का चयन करें।

ध्यान दें

आप सिम्युलेटर में सिरीकिट एप्लिकेशन का परीक्षण नहीं कर सकते। इसके बजाय, आपको एक वास्तविक उपकरण की आवश्यकता है।



Modified text is an extract of the original Stack Overflow Documentation
के तहत लाइसेंस प्राप्त है CC BY-SA 3.0
से संबद्ध नहीं है Stack Overflow